
Wildlight Entertainment, the team behind popular games like Apex Legends and Titanfall, revealed Highguard, a free-to-play first-person shooter where players compete in raids. It will be available on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series, and PC (through Steam) on January 26, 2026, and will support cross-play and cross-progression, letting players play and make progress on any platform.
Dusty Welch, co-founder and CEO of Wildlight Entertainment, announced that the team – a group of experienced developers who previously worked on popular games like Apex Legends, Call of Duty, and Titanfall – is now creating its own ambitious new game and universe. “We’re aiming for the same level of quality and scope as those previous hits,” Welch stated in a press release.
As a huge fan of both Apex Legends and Titanfall, I was really excited to hear from Chad Grenier, one of the founders of Wildlight Entertainment. He explained that they started the studio because they wanted the freedom to create new games and really focus on design without having to compromise their vision. He said working on those earlier games taught them everything they know about building and keeping a game popular for years to come.











Here is an overview of the game, via Wildlight Entertainment:
The team behind Apex Legends and Titanfall presents Highguard, a new multiplayer raid shooter. Players take on the role of Wardens – powerful gunslingers who battle for dominance over a legendary continent, engaging in both mounted combat and strategic raids.
Compete against other teams as Wardens, fighting to capture the Shieldbreaker. Once you have it, infiltrate and demolish the enemy base to claim new territory in this innovative shooter game.
